In this article, we explain what DataOps is, how this methodology works, and how it supports collaboration among teams working with data.  <\/p>\n\n<h2 class=\"wp-block-heading\"><strong>What Is DataOps?<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\"><strong>DataOps is a methodology for managing data-related processes, aimed at delivering information for analysis faster, more predictably, and with better control. <\/strong>Simply put, DataOps organizes the entire data workflow\u2014from the moment data is acquired from various systems, through integration and quality control, to making ready-to-use data available to analysts and business users.<\/p>\n\n<p class=\"wp-block-paragraph\">It combines principles known from DevOps and <a href=\"https:\/\/businessintelligence.pl\/en\/slownik\/agile-agility\/\">Agile<\/a> with the domain of data analytics, system integration, and Business Intelligence. As a result, organizations can improve collaboration between business teams, analysts, and data engineers, and reduce the time needed to prepare reliable data. <\/p>\n\n<p class=\"wp-block-paragraph\">Unlike traditional approaches, DataOps treats data as part of a continuous process that requires monitoring, automation, and constant improvement. It covers the entire data lifecycle\u2014from acquisition from source systems, through integration and transformation, to making data available in reports, dashboards, and AI models. <\/p>\n\n<p class=\"wp-block-paragraph\"><strong>The key principles of DataOps are:<\/strong><\/p>\n\n<ul class=\"wp-block-list\">\n<li>automation of data processing workflows,<\/li>\n\n\n\n<li>continuous quality control at every stage,<\/li>\n\n\n\n<li>improved collaboration between business and technical teams,<\/li>\n\n\n\n<li>standardization of analytical processes,<\/li>\n\n\n\n<li>faster delivery of data to business users.<\/li>\n<\/ul>\n\n<h3 class=\"wp-block-heading\"><strong>What Are the Differences Between DataOps and DevOps?<\/strong><\/h3>\n\n<p class=\"wp-block-paragraph\">Although DataOps originates from the DevOps philosophy, both approaches focus on different areas. DevOps streamlines the process of creating, testing, and deploying software, while DataOps focuses on managing the entire data lifecycle. <\/p>\n\n<p class=\"wp-block-paragraph\">The key difference is that in DevOps, the primary product is a working application, whereas in DataOps, it is reliable and up-to-date data. As a result, companies can respond more quickly to changing market conditions, plan actions better, and more effectively leverage the potential of Business Intelligence and AI. <\/p>\n\n<h2 class=\"wp-block-heading\"><strong>How Does DataOps Work in Practice?<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">The easiest way to understand DataOps is through the example of a company that prepares daily sales reports for management. Data comes from multiple sources: an ERP system, CRM, e-commerce platform, and marketing tools. Without a properly designed process, analysts must manually download data, check its accuracy, remove errors, and prepare reports. Any change in one of the systems can delay the entire process. In the DataOps model, most of these actions happen automatically.    <\/p>\n\n<p class=\"wp-block-paragraph\"><strong>The process looks as follows:<\/strong><\/p>\n\n<ol start=\"1\" class=\"wp-block-list\">\n<li><strong>Data Retrieval<\/strong> \u2013 the integration platform automatically retrieves data from all systems according to a set schedule or in real time.<\/li>\n\n\n\n<li><strong>Data Quality Control<\/strong> \u2013 even before analysis begins, the system checks for duplicates, missing values, inconsistent formats, or other errors that could affect report results.<\/li>\n\n\n\n<li><strong>Transformation and Integration<\/strong> \u2013 data is standardized and combined into a single analytical model. At this stage, KPIs may be calculated, product names standardized, or common customer identifiers assigned. <\/li>\n\n\n\n<li><strong>Automatic Data Delivery<\/strong> \u2013 the ready model is delivered to the Business Intelligence platform, where business users access up-to-date dashboards and reports without needing to manually prepare data.<\/li>\n\n\n\n<li><strong>Process Monitoring<\/strong> \u2013 DataOps does not end with data loading. The system continuously monitors pipeline operations and alerts about issues such as missing data from one source, failed integration, or a sudden drop in data quality. <\/li>\n<\/ol>\n\n<p class=\"wp-block-paragraph\">This approach significantly shortens the time to deliver information to the business. Instead of spending hours preparing data, teams can focus on analysis and drawing conclusions. This is especially important in Business Intelligence environments and AI projects, where even small data errors can lead to incorrect analyses or faulty recommendations.  <\/p>\n\n<h2 class=\"wp-block-heading\"><strong>What Are the Key Principles and Stages of the DataOps Lifecycle?<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">The DataOps lifecycle describes how an organization designs, tests, deploys, and oversees data flows. The most important thing is that each change is small, controlled, and can be quickly rolled back. Therefore, the team does not wait for one large project, but regularly develops data pipelines and checks their impact on reporting, Business Intelligence, and AI models.  <\/p>\n\n<p class=\"wp-block-paragraph\"><strong>Key DataOps principles include:<\/strong><\/p>\n\n<ul class=\"wp-block-list\">\n<li><strong>iterative deployment of changes<\/strong> \u2013 new sources, transformation rules, and models are deployed to the environment in stages,<\/li>\n\n\n\n<li><strong>automated testing<\/strong> \u2013 the system checks the structure, completeness, and correctness of data before publication,<\/li>\n\n\n\n<li><strong>versioning<\/strong> \u2013 changes to scripts, rules, and data models are documented,<\/li>\n\n\n\n<li><strong>process observability<\/strong> \u2013 teams monitor processing time, errors, and result quality,<\/li>\n\n\n\n<li><strong>shared responsibility<\/strong> \u2013 business, analysts, and engineers work toward the same goals and quality criteria.<\/li>\n<\/ul>\n\n<p class=\"wp-block-paragraph\"><a href=\"https:\/\/businessintelligence.pl\/en\/blog\/\"><strong>Learn more about Business Intelligence from our blog!<\/strong><\/a><strong><u><\/u><\/strong><\/p>\n\n<h3 class=\"wp-block-heading\"><strong>Designing a Change<\/strong><\/h3>\n\n<p class=\"wp-block-paragraph\">The cycle begins with a specific business need, such as adding return data to a sales dashboard. The team defines the information source, required level of currency, quality rules, and data recipients. This ensures the pipeline is not created in isolation from real-world use.  <\/p>\n\n<h3 class=\"wp-block-heading\"><strong>Building and Versioning the Pipeline<\/strong><\/h3>\n\n<p class=\"wp-block-paragraph\">Next, engineers create or modify the data flow. Changes are saved in a version repository, allowing comparison of successive variants and quick restoration of earlier configurations. This stage resembles working on application code, but concerns rules for retrieving, transforming, and delivering data.  <\/p>\n\n<h3 class=\"wp-block-heading\"><strong>Automated Tests<\/strong><\/h3>\n\n<p class=\"wp-block-paragraph\">Before deployment, the system checks whether the new data meets established conditions. Tests can detect missing records, a sudden increase in duplicates, a change in field format, or inconsistency with the expected value range. If the check fails, the data does not reach the reports.  <\/p>\n\n<h3 class=\"wp-block-heading\"><strong>Controlled Deployment<\/strong><\/h3>\n\n<p class=\"wp-block-paragraph\">After successful tests, the change is deployed to the production environment. The organization can first deploy it for a selected group of users or a single report. This approach limits the risk that an error will affect the entire analytical layer.  <\/p>\n\n<h3 class=\"wp-block-heading\"><strong>Monitoring and Feedback<\/strong><\/h3>\n\n<p class=\"wp-block-paragraph\">After deployment, the pipeline is continuously monitored. The team analyzes delays, errors, data quality, and user reactions. If a dashboard starts showing unusual results or one of the sources stops delivering information, the system should quickly generate an alert.  <\/p>\n\n<h3 class=\"wp-block-heading\"><strong>Process Improvement<\/strong><\/h3>\n\n<p class=\"wp-block-paragraph\">The final stage leads directly to the next cycle. Collected data on performance and quality help improve rules, remove bottlenecks, and better align the solution with business needs. DataOps therefore operates as a continuous improvement loop, not a one-time integration project.  <\/p>\n\n<p class=\"wp-block-paragraph\">This working model allows the data environment to evolve without losing control over changes. Automatic feeding of data models means dashboards are updated faster, users work with the same information, and analytical teams can spend more time interpreting results instead of manually preparing data. <\/p>\n\n<h2 class=\"wp-block-heading\"><strong>How to Implement DataOps in an Organization?<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">Implementing DataOps requires connecting processes, teams, and tools that automate the entire data workflow. It is not about purchasing a single platform, but about creating an environment where data is versioned, tested, monitored, and securely delivered to BI reports and AI models. <\/p>\n\n<p class=\"wp-block-paragraph\"><strong>The implementation process can be divided into several stages:<\/strong><\/p>\n\n<ol start=\"1\" class=\"wp-block-list\">\n<li><strong>Map Sources and Data Flows<br\/><\/strong>Identify ERP systems, CRM, e-commerce, databases, files, and APIs. Determine how data flows between them and where delays, errors, and manual operations occur. <\/li>\n\n\n\n<li><strong>Introduce Change Versioning<br\/><\/strong>ETL scripts, transformation rules, and pipeline configurations should be stored in a repository, such as Git. This allows the team to track changes, compare versions, and quickly restore earlier settings.  <\/li>\n\n\n\n<li><strong>Automate Data Integration and Orchestration<br\/><\/strong>ETL\/ELT tools and data integration platforms, such as Talend, help retrieve, clean, and combine data from multiple sources. Orchestration allows tasks to run in the correct order and respond to errors without manual intervention. <\/li>\n\n\n\n<li><strong>Implement Automated Quality Tests<br\/><\/strong>Each pipeline should check data completeness, correctness, currency, and uniqueness. Tests should block data publication when the system detects, for example, missing records, a change in field format, or a sudden increase in duplicates. <\/li>\n\n\n\n<li><strong>Apply CI\/CD Practices for Data<br\/><\/strong>Changes to pipelines should first be tested in a development environment, then in a test environment, and only then in production. This approach limits the risk that an incorrect transformation will affect reports, dashboards, or AI models. <\/li>\n\n\n\n<li><strong>Monitor Pipelines and Set Alerts<br\/><\/strong>The organization should track processing time, source availability, error count, and result quality. Alerts help quickly detect that data from one system has not arrived or that the loading process has failed. <\/li>\n\n\n\n<li><strong>Connect the Data Layer with Business Intelligence<br\/><\/strong>Verified data should automatically feed BI platforms such as Qlik. This way, users receive up-to-date dashboards and reports without manually exporting files or recalculating KPIs multiple times. <\/li>\n<\/ol>\n\n<p class=\"wp-block-paragraph\">Implementation is best started with one specific process, such as a daily sales report. After organizing sources, tests, monitoring, and automation, DataOps can gradually be extended to other areas.
